A member asked:

Ill be 37 weeks in two day. ive been dealing with swelling in my ankles and feet as well as my hands sometimes and had to quit my job because the standing and reaching was causing a lot of pain. is it safe for me to try inducing myself at home?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

Self-Induction Labor: There is an old saying about doctors who treat themselves: "A doctor who treats themself has a fool for a patient." It is no less appropriate for patients. Induction is an intensive medical process that requires specialized medical & nursing care that has significant risks for mother & baby! Also excess edema can be a sign of preeclampsia. Call your ob doctor right away.
